Step 1: Assessment and Containment
We’ll start by assessing the extent of the water damage and containing the affected area to prevent further damage. This may involve setting up drying equipment and containing the area with tarps or plastic sheets.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Drying
Next, we’ll extract the standing water and begin the drying process using indust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ers. This may take several hours or days, depending on the severity of the damage.
Step 3: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the drying process is complete, we’ll cl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ent mold growth and remove any lingering bacteria or odors.
Step 4: Restoration and Repair
Finally, we’ll restore and repair any damaged parts of your HVAC system, including replacing damaged parts and inspecting the system for any further damage.

HVAC Leak Water Removal Cost in Visalia, CA
The cost of HVAC leak water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Visalia, CA. On average, you can expect to pay $500-$2,500 for water damage restoration services. But, this cost can increase if you need to replace damaged parts or repair electrical systems.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500-$1,500 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Restoration and repair of damaged parts | $1,000-$3,000 | Complexity of repair and materials needed |
| Inspection and testing of electrical systems | $500-$1,000 | Severity of damage and complexity of repair |
| Mold removal and remediation | $1,000-$3,000 | Size of affected area and severity of mold growth |
| Replacement of damaged parts (e.g. HVAC unit) | $2,000-$5,000 | Complexity of replacement and materials needed |
